Output f943c405bb74db0d9cfd7997657f533861c83d680c015b607026cbacf94ee31b:0

value
21673762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8acac520f0e41b2bb024a0501547dbeb3bf55bf OP_EQUAL
address
3Kz5vSzpvZLJoDgawA1DWj6YCZvcbg3DQM
transaction
f943c405bb74db0d9cfd7997657f533861c83d680c015b607026cbacf94ee31b
spent
true